Main duties of the job

The staff are involved in all aspects of the breast care pathway providing standard mammography, additional views and stereo biopsy, tomography and contrast enhanced mammography.

Successful applicants will be involved in standard breast screening which takes place at County Hospital and several locations across the North Midlands screening area serviced by a mobile demountable unit and a brand new mobile van.

Both the Royal Stoke and County Hospitals boast busy 2 week wait/ one stop clinics where the applicant will be involved in providing standard mammography, tomography and additional views as well as chaperoning in ultrasound and providing biopsy support. The Royal Stoke unit has contrast enhanced mammography and the opportunity for staff to train in cannulation and gain experience in performing this new technique.

Screening assessment clinics are carried out at both Hospital sites and staff have a pivotal role in these clinics including some staff who train further in clinical breast examination and advanced communication skills.
